The Diameter Interworking Function Iwf Market- is poised for robust growth over the next decade as telecom operators and enterprises increasingly rely on seamless network interoperability. With the global market valued at USD 2.30 billion in 2024, it is projected to reach USD 2.47 billion by 2025 and escalate to USD 5.06 billion by 2035, reflecting a strong compound annual growth rate (CAGR) of 7.41% during the forecast period.
This market expansion is driven by several key factors, including the rising adoption of LTE services, the rapid deployment of 5G networks, and the growing demand for real-time authentication and secure mobile data transmission. The increasing integration of IoT devices across industries also necessitates reliable interworking functions to ensure smooth communication between legacy and next-generation network systems.

Key Market Segmentation
The market is broadly segmented based on deployment type, end user, application, component, and regional presence:
-
Deployment Type: On-premise, cloud-based, and hybrid deployment models.
-
End Users: Telecom operators, IT service providers, and enterprise network operators.
-
Applications: LTE services, 5G interworking, IoT device management, and cloud-based authentication solutions.
-
Components: Diameter signaling controllers, network function virtualization components, and security modules.
-
Regions: North America, Europe, Asia-Pacific (APAC), South America, and the Middle East & Africa (MEA).
North America currently holds a leading share due to advanced telecom infrastructure, while APAC is projected to grow rapidly with increased 5G deployment and IoT adoption.
Competitive Landscape
The Diameter Interworking Function Iwf Market features a mix of established technology vendors and telecom solution providers. Key players profiled include Oracle, Mavenir, F5 Networks, Amdocs, Huawei, Juniper Networks, Accenture, NEC, ZTE, Nokia, Ericsson, IBM, Wipro, Netcracker Technology, and Cisco. These companies focus on strategic partnerships, technology innovation, and cloud-based deployments to strengthen their market presence.
